UI Designer Salary in St Helens, United Kingdom

St Helens has a tech pay scale. Mid‑level UI designers earn around £30,000 per year.

Salary by experience level

Entry-level (0-2 years)

Salary range (per year)

£21,000 to £26,500

Average (per year)

£24,000

Entry-level designers work for local agencies or SMEs, gaining experience with digital interfaces for retail and service clients.

Mid-level (3-5 years)

Salary range (per year)

£26,500 to £34,000

Average (per year)

£30,000

Mid-level roles support larger brands or public sector projects, with responsibilities that grow as design skills and project autonomy increase.

Senior (6-9 years)

Salary range (per year)

£34,000 to £42,000

Average (per year)

£38,000

Senior designers lead small teams or major campaigns, with responsibilities reflecting experience and client outcomes.

Principal/Lead (10+ years)

Salary range (per year)

£42,000+

Principal or lead designers in St Helens work in consultancy or for national firms with local branches.

Hourly Rates

For freelance or contract work, hourly rates are typically higher than equivalent salaried positions.

Junior

£13 - £18

per hour

Mid-level

£18 - £25

per hour

Senior

£25 - £35

per hour

Nationally, UI designers average about £38,000, so St Helens sits below the UK mean. Living costs are lower in the area.
